Tea and cakes at Toad Hall for the community of Blackden, 30 May 2009.
Over twenty people attended the party and enjoyed the beautiful sunshine and the delicious cakes served by many hard working volunteers. Griselda Garner gave an interesting account of how the site evolved over the years to become The Blackden Trust and tirelessly guided many visitors on a tour of the Old Medicine House.
